CEE 305

Soil Mechanics I

Engineering and Technology
B.Eng. Environmental Engineering
2
Course Description
At the end of this course, the students should be to: 1. measure soil properties in the laboratory; 2. interpret and summarise data soil classification; 3. determine the optimum conditions for compaction of soils and the ultimate amount achievable; and 4. estimate the settlement of soils due to compaction and consolidation.
Course Outline
Mineralogy of soils. Soil structures. Formation of soils. Soil classification. Engineering properties of soils. Soil in water relationship – void ratio, porosity, specific gravity, permeability, and other factors. Atterberg limits – particle size distribution. shear strength of soils, Mohr’s stress circle. Compaction and soil stabilization. Settlement. Theory of consolidation. Laboratory work.
